#1c7637 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c7637 is composed of 11% red, 46.3%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 28.6%. #1c7637 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ec6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1c7637 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c7637 has RGB values of R:28, G:118,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1865271.

Shades and Tints of #1c7637
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c7637
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494949 is the less saturated color, while #068c2e is the most saturated one.
